Arriving at the Taj Mahal, the anticipation builds. As one of India’s top destinations, the monument’s symmetry, intricate marble work, and tranquil gardens are stunning in person. The tour usually begins with a walk around the exterior, followed by a guided inside visit where the stories of Shah Jahan and Mumtaz Mahal come to life.

Next up is Agra Fort, a sprawling fortress that combines Hindu and Central Asian architectural influences. The guide will lead you through a maze of courtyards, private chambers, and mosques, explaining the historical importance of each.
Travelers often appreciate the chance to see the intricate craftsmanship—think marble inlay, detailed carvings, and grand halls. One reviewer mentioned how the guide helped convey the story of the Mughal Empire through these structures, making the visit both educational and engaging.

An hour’s drive from Agra leads to Fatehpur Sikri, a UNESCO site built during the empire’s height. You’ll have around 90 minutes to explore this well-preserved city, renowned for its elegant buildings, courtyards, and intricate architecture.
Reviewers mention that guides often highlight the history of this abandoned city, which was constructed at the height of Mughal power. The carefully maintained structures and the peaceful atmosphere make it a highlight of the tour.

Is hotel pickup and drop-off included? Yes, the tour provides hotel pickup and drop-off within Delhi.
How long is the drive from Delhi to Agra? The trip typically takes around four hours each way, depending on traffic.
What sites are visited during the tour? The tour includes visits to the Taj Mahal, Agra Fort, and Fatehpur Sikri.
Is the Taj Mahal visited on Fridays? No, the Taj Mahal is closed on Fridays, so the tour is not available on that day.
Are guides knowledgeable? Absolutely, reviews emphasize that guides are well-informed and share interesting stories about Mughal rulers and architecture.
What is included in the price? Private transportation, a guide, hotel pickup and drop-off, and lunch are all included.
Can I cancel the tour? Yes, with free cancellation available up to 24 hours before the scheduled start.
Is this tour suitable for children or elderly? Most travelers can participate, but the long day might be tiring for very young children or those with mobility issues.
What should I wear? Dress comfortably and respectfully—covering shoulders and knees is advisable at religious sites.
